Output e5f93b29d7003b05c2d3de2e6483c78d2625762a2f7d7a32868756ab32bb4f14:4

value
295760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 615f339c64da899274cf0e7748278e0fa6ef6a52 OP_EQUAL
address
3AZsWsh4Gg8gfxcGDgPYXWi5aFqEwwfAQF
transaction
e5f93b29d7003b05c2d3de2e6483c78d2625762a2f7d7a32868756ab32bb4f14
spent
true